Molino el Pujol is a traditional tortilleria in Mexico City run by the famous chef Enrique Olvera. They're all about keeping it old school, making their tortillas from scratch using ancient techniques like nixtamalization. The result? Creamy, delicious tortillas that are a far cry from the mass-produced stuff you find at the grocery store. Plus, they're all about supporting small-scale Mexican corn farmers and preserving the rich culinary traditions of Mexico. It's basically a love letter to corn, one tortilla at a time.
